How do I choose a on line lifetime insurance firm?
Greater than 1000 lives ins associations sell living insurance coverage inside the U.S., but a lot of them are constituents with groups of firms and so are not really competition with each other. Moreover, not each company retains a company licensed to operate in each U.S. state. As a general rule, you are supposed to purchase from a establishment approved inside your state, because in that case may you depend on your state insurance department to help in case there is any trouble.
Here are more than a few additional ideas to consider while picking a online lifetime insurance coverage group: Goods - the majority of companies sell a wide variety of lives insurance plans or aspects, so select the corporation that vends the product and features that fulfill your requirements. Financial Soundness - on line life coverage is an extended arrangement. Select a establishment which is likely to be monetarily solid for a lot of years, with using ratings from independent scoring operations. Business principles - a number of on line lifetime assurance corporations adhere to those ethics or codes of management of the Insurance Marketplace Standards Association, a not for profit establishment which advances moral behavior in permanent living insurance marketing. Recommendations and help - on behalf of a lot of persons, online lifetime ins is an unfamiliar, complicated thing, so it may be easier to trade with an agent in the company of whom you may communicate and that is listening carefully in regard to your requirements. This may be connected to a choice of the online life assurance organization since some representatives act for just one or otherwise a very few on line lifetime coverage organizations. Claims - you might want look up a nationwide claims database in order to observe what complaint data the website retains on a company. Additionally, the state coverage department may be able to convey you if a lifetime ins establishment you are considering doing commerce in the company of had a lot of customer complaints regarding the company`s help relative against the amount of policies the company sold.
Payment and cost - The premium will be the amount you disburse a firm intended for a permanent lifetime insurance agreement with every part of its reimbursements. Even on behalf of a given death reimbursement or type of coverage (e.g., period life), the premium can differ widely among firms, either because some companies` plans have aspects which other ones do not, or because some cost more than other ones on behalf of the same coverage.
